Athletes Urged to Enter the Greater Edendale Race

Local athletes and fun-runners have been urged to get their entry in for this weekend’s Greater Edendale Race as soon as possible. The Comrades Marathon Association (CMA) will host the much-loved 10km community race on Sunday, 17 November 2019 at the FNB Wadley Stadium for the 13th time since its inception in 2007.

Entries are being taken at Comrades House – 18 Connaught Road, Scottsville, Pietermaritzburg during office hours.

CMA Marketing Manager, Thami Vilakazi says, “Entries will also be taken on race day at the FNB Wadley Stadium from 05h00 to 07h00 but we do urge our runners to enter before then so as to minimise delays on the day.”

The race starts at 07h30 and costs R90.00 for licensed runners whilst unlicensed runners will pay R120.00 which includes a temporary licence. The cut-off time is 2 hours and 30 minutes; and entrants must be 14 years or older.

Prize money totalling more than R20-thousand as well as additional lucky draw prizes are up for grabs whilst T-shirts and medals will be awarded to all finishers.

The event is one of the CMA’s longest running CSI initiatives, which is hosted together with the Msunduzi Municipality, the uMsunduzi Pietermaritzburg Tourism Association (MPTA) and supported by media partner, Msunduzi Eyethu.
